Bicycles given out by NRM not part of govt pledge – Minister

KAMPALA – On Sunday, August 16, 2020, President Museveni flagged off the distribution of 68,733 bicycles to all NRM village chairpersons across the country.

The bicycles are to be used in mobilising support for the ruling party in the 2021 general elections.

This raised public concern that the bicycles given out by Mr Museveni on Sunday are the same earlier promised by his government over two years ago.

In July, 2018, the government through the State Minister for Local Government, Ms Jennipher Namuyangu revealed that every Local Council One (LCI) chairperson would be entitled to a bicycle to ease administration and running of the village duties. Each LCI chairperson would then be expected to hand over the bicycle to his or her successor at the end of their term of office.

However, the State minister for Information, Communication and Technology, Mr Peter Ogwang, said the bicycles being distributed by NRM are not part of the government pledge for LCI chairpersons made in 2018.

“I want to assure the country and specifically the LCs that the government is undertaking to procure bicycles for all LCs as far as LCIs are concerned. The ones you see here today are for the party but the ones of government, work is ongoing,” Mr Ogwang stated.

“The money has already been secured and the government process is going on within the ministry of Local Government,” he added.
